As for the SVT & 8x10, yes it was a bit limited for serious oomph. And I suspect derived from the "sweet sixteen" design offered in an early 60's Popular Electronics. However, many's the time I got to see Jack Casady with a dozen or so 18" - probably K151 JBL - powered by 3 or 4 SVT - and that rig was by far not lacking in 40 Hz wallop whether indoors or out. Choice of speakers is important. Why force 10's to that task, no matter how "specially designed", when 18's reproduce that part of the spectrum with far less strain.
